Sida 1 av 1

Problem med optokopplare [Löst: för låg CTR]

Postat: 4 februari 2016, 21:55:33
av gripner
har en koppling enligt bilden. Signal in på sig3 via R3 för att få lagom ström. 30mA ok för komponenten.
VCC = 5 volt
R2 är pullup för att ha hög ingång
när spänning appliseras på SIG3 borde ju den gulmarkerade punkten droppa från 5V till 0V.
Vilken den inte gör utan till typ 4.78V

Är jag snurrig eller ?

Är det för signalen in är samma som VCC ?


Edit: fixade rubrik - hcb

Re: hjärnsläpp

Postat: 4 februari 2016, 22:00:06
av RDX*
Om SIG 3 är en 5V logiksignal så blir det en ström på ca 1.6mA

Re: hjärnsläpp

Postat: 4 februari 2016, 22:06:19
av gripner
R3 är inte 3K, sorry missade att säga att det är utbytt 150ish ohm

Re: hjärnsläpp

Postat: 4 februari 2016, 22:28:35
av YD1150
Finns en parameter till optokopplare som heter CTR.

http://www.renesas.eu/products/opto/technology/ctr/

Byt ut 2,2k till 10k eller högre.

Re: hjärnsläpp

Postat: 4 februari 2016, 22:57:19
av gripner
tack för tipset!

Gjorde massor med skillnad!

fototransistorn öppnar inte fullt vilket påverkar spänningen. med större motstånd öppnar den mer och kommer närmare 0. blir lite mer känslig för oönskad läsning dock, men blir nog bra.

Nu skall man bara komma på hur man lätt kan räkna hur många sådanna här kretsar har "öppnat" med minst antal input på en uC.
Man tänker ju inte snabbt så sent.

Re: hjärnsläpp

Postat: 4 februari 2016, 23:17:53
av gripner
Tar det som en ny fråga,

Tänk att man har 120st signaler som kan vara antingen 1 eller 0, hur räknar man hur många som är 1 med minst antal pinnar på en uC
ett Matris,

eller något i2c adressregister?
Någon som har bra ideer?

Re: hjärnsläpp

Postat: 4 februari 2016, 23:45:40
av sodjan
> fototransistorn öppnar inte fullt vilket påverkar spänningen. med större motstånd öppnar den mer...

Njae. Den öppnar lika mycket, men i relation till pull-up motstånden så
kommer ju utgången att få en lägre spänning. Det finns optokopplare med
darlingron steg med höge förstärkning mellan in och utgång.

Re: hjärnsläpp

Postat: 5 februari 2016, 06:23:02
av Swech
bygg 8 st DA steg med 9 bitar i varje DA R-2R stege...

Swech

Re: Problem med optokopplare [Löst: för låg CTR]

Postat: 5 februari 2016, 10:55:12
av xxargs
skiftesregister typ 74HC597 i en lång kedja eller flera parallella kedjor

det finns säkert fler kretsar som kan göra samma sak.